This is a construction detail of a multi story brick office building. Important things to note regarding this section are that there are multiple ways of constructing this, i have shown a brick construction. This section also gives window and entrance door details. the structural system uses both primary and secondary beams, which are 'I' beam coated inc concrete, they work on like a grid system and is hard to differentiate in a sectional view. Thus the secondary beam is not seen visually here yet hidden behind the primary beam. The ceiling is a suspended one, the beauty of having a bondek slab is that the accessories available with it, you can purchase little clips which lock into the bondek and suspend the ceiling from cables giving a nice neat ceiling. The weep holes are also important to note their location, just above every flashing where the brick is cut into to allow a window or a door.
